对自主编码工具的期望:测试Gemini CLI

对自主编码工具的期望:测试Gemini CLI

💡 原文英文,约1500词,阅读约需6分钟。
📝

内容提要

谷歌的Gemini CLI是一个开源AI终端应用,旨在提升开发者体验。它简化命令行操作,支持环境变量设置API密钥,并提供项目目录和模型信息。Gemini CLI允许用户在项目目录内安全操作,支持JSON文件合并,整体高效易用。

🎯

关键要点

  • 谷歌的Gemini CLI是一个开源AI终端应用,旨在提升开发者体验。
  • Gemini CLI简化命令行操作,支持环境变量设置API密钥。
  • 用户可以在项目目录内安全操作,并支持JSON文件合并。
  • 开发者需要简单的命令行启动体验,能够快速连接API密钥。
  • 启动时需要提供模型信息、项目目录和权限信息的摘要。
  • Gemini CLI允许用户使用macOS Seatbelt来限制AI的访问权限。
  • 用户可以通过npm安装Gemini CLI,并设置API密钥。
  • Gemini CLI支持合并JSON文件,并能处理更新和新条目的添加。
  • Gemini CLI提供了高效的操作体验,适合开发者使用。

延伸问答

Gemini CLI的主要功能是什么?

Gemini CLI是一个开源AI终端应用,旨在提升开发者体验,简化命令行操作,支持环境变量设置API密钥,并提供项目目录和模型信息。

如何安装Gemini CLI?

可以通过npm在终端中使用命令'npm install -g @google/gemini-cli'来安装Gemini CLI。

Gemini CLI如何处理JSON文件?

Gemini CLI支持合并JSON文件,并能处理更新和新条目的添加,允许用户在项目中安全操作。

Gemini CLI在启动时需要哪些信息?

启动时需要提供模型信息、项目目录和权限信息的摘要。

Gemini CLI如何确保安全性?

Gemini CLI可以使用macOS Seatbelt来限制AI的访问权限,确保用户在项目目录内安全操作。

Gemini CLI的用户体验如何?

Gemini CLI提供了高效的操作体验,适合开发者使用,能够快速连接API密钥并简化命令行操作。

➡️

继续阅读